Pac 7 teams keep on spiking

By MIKE DUPREZ

The Hub

 

VOLLEYBALL

 

*Karrington Batten had 14 kills and 4 blocks in Trinity’s 27-25, 25-17, 25-17 win over Asheboro. Sarabeth Johnson had 12 kills and 6 digs for the Bulldogs. Faith Powell had 8 aces and 11 digs. Madison Burgiss had 28 assists and 3 kills. Kaitlyn McCoy had 7 kills and 5 digs.

 

Piper Davidson had 6 kills, 7 digs and an ace for Asheboro. 

 

*Kenzie Hill had 6 aces, 3 kills and 2 digs in Uwharrie Charter’s 25-17, 25-16, 25-18 win over Ledford. Chloe Painter had 6 kills, 4 blocks, 3 digs and an ace for the Eagles. Dacia Lowery had 5 kills and 2 blocks.

 

*Emma Mazzarone pounded 10 kills while Dyyanna Wade had 8 in Providence Grove’s 25-20, 25-11, 25-9 win over Jordan-Matthews. Riley Mazzarone and Gracey Menscer both had 16 assists for the Patriots. Mailey Way had 18 digs.

 

*Haley Pease had 15 kills and 9 digs in Wheatmore’s 25-14, 25-22, 23-25, 19-25, 15-12 loss to Southeast Guilford.

 

*Johnson had 15 kills in Trinity’s 25-11, 25-22, 25-14 win over Southern Guilford. McCoy and Batten each had 10 kills while  Greene contributed 20 assists, 2 aces and 3 digs. Burgiss had 31 assists.

 

*Lowery had 10 kills and 3 blocks in Uwharrie Charter’s 25-20, 24-26, 27-25, 25-16 win over Richmond. Lizah Moore had 6 blocks and 4 kills. Kayden Faglier had 5 blocks, 3 kills and a block.

 

*Emma Mazzarone had 22 kills and 9 digs in Providence Grove’s 25-19, 25-20, 19-25, 25-21 loss to Ledford. Paige Needham had 11 kills and 2 blocks for the Patriots. Wade contributed 6 blocks and 5 kills. Menscer had 28 assists and 14 digs. Riley Mazzarone had 12 assists. Way had 14 digs and 3 aces.

 

*Lucy Lockwood had 11 kills and 2 blocks in Wheatmore’s 25-20, 25-19, 25-22 win over Asheboro. Pease had 10 kills, 7 digs and 3 aces for the Warriors. Lanie McMahan had 11 assists, 3 digs and 3 aces.

 

Long had 11 kills, 3 blocks and 3 aces for Asheboro. Lia George had 7 digs and 5 kills.

 

*Burgiss had 21 assists while McCoy had 12 kills and 9 digs in Trinity’s 25-13, 25-10, 25-19 win over High Point Central. Johnson contributed 8 aces and 6 kills. Batten got seven kills. 

 

*Riley Key pounded 16 kills in Southwestern Randolph’s 25-21, 25-15, 25-19 sweep of Asheboro. Madeline Smith and Gracie Hodgin each had nine kills.

 

Sion Murrain and Long each had four kills for the Blue Comets.

 

*McMahan had 17 assists and 8 digs as Wheatmore overcame Central Davidson 19-25, 25-20, 25-13, 18-25, 15-12. Haley Greene had 19 assists, 6 digs and 3 aces for the Warriors. Taylor Richardson amassed 15 kills and 8 digs.

 

*Emma Mazzarone had 19 kills and Riley Mazzarone collected 39 assists in Providence Grove’s 25-12, 26-24, 25-19 win over East Davidson. Allie Frazier had 14 digs and 10 kills. Way had 15 digs.

 

SOCCER

 

*Cristian Ortiz scored a hat trick in Asheboro’s 4-0 win over reigning 3-A state champion Western Alamance. 

 

*Collin Burgess and Riley Queen each scored two goals in Wheatmore’s 7-1 thumping of Lexington.

 

*Diego Torres scored two goals in Trinity’s 5-0 win over Thomasville.

 

GOLF

 

*Asheboro’s Salem Lee turned in another outstanding effort by shooting a 1-under-par 35 in the Blue Comets’ match with Rockingham County. That earned her medalist honors.

 

BASEBALL

 

*Former Randleman star Brooks Brannon hit .462 in his first five games with the Rookie League affiliate of the Boston Red Sox. Brannon was selected in the ninth round.

 

*Former Asheboro and Post 45 star Tanner Marsh committed to Liberty University.
